Hello, My name is Andrew Bertaina, and I am the author of a new essay collection that isn't currently in the database.
The title is: The Body Is A Temporary Gathering Place. Pub Date: May 28, 2024 Print Length: 184 pages Dimensions: 5.5 x 8.5 inches ISBN: 978-1-957392-30-1 Paperback Description: Andrew Bertaina is going through a mid-life crisis: failed marriage, child-rearing, self-doubt, ennui, the works. Naturally, Bertaina does what any of us would do; he draws inspiration from the poster boy of mid-life crisis chroniclers, the 16th-century essayist Michele de Montaigne, channeling misgivings into meditations, lostness into longing. The essays in The Body Is A Temporary Gathering Place deal with a variety of timeless and universal topics: e.g., how to woo a French woman on a train, male caregiving, how to cannibalize your spouse, and the riddle of time. The essays promise no answers. They do, however, strive to capture the beauty that lingers in a life passing all too quickly.
